How are low pressure, medium pressure, high pressure, and vacuum defined in pressure vessels?
1. Low pressure (code L): 0.1MPa ≤ P < 1.6MPa 2. Medium pressure (code M): 1.6MPa ≤ P < 10MPa 3. High pressure (code H): 10MPa ≤ P < 100MPa 4. Ultra-high pressure (code U): P ≥ 100MPa 5. Vacuum vessel: A vessel in which the pressure of the medium inside is lower than the ambient atmospheric pressure, i.e., it operates under vacuum conditions. 6. Atmospheric pressure vessel: A vessel that is directly connected to the ambient atmosphere or operates at a gauge pressure of 0; vessels with a design pressure ranging from greater than -0.02MPa to less than 0.1MPa are considered atmospheric pressure vessels
